Oil Prices Stabilize, Set For Weekly Decline Amid U.S. Economic Concerns

The sun sets behind a crude oil pump jack on a drill pad in the Permian Basin in Loving County

Oil prices have stabilized after a period of volatility, with the market heading for a weekly decline amid concerns about the U.S. economy. The global oil market has been closely monitoring economic indicators from the United States, a major consumer of oil, as signs of a slowdown in economic growth have raised worries about future demand for oil.

Despite the recent fluctuations, oil prices have managed to hold steady in the face of uncertainty. This stability comes as a relief to investors and industry players who have been closely watching the market for any signs of further turbulence.

The U.S.-China trade tensions and geopolitical uncertainties have also contributed to the cautious sentiment in the oil market. These factors have added to the overall uncertainty surrounding the global economy and have kept oil prices under pressure.

Analysts are closely monitoring the situation and are expecting further developments in the coming days. The outcome of key economic data releases and geopolitical events will likely have a significant impact on the direction of oil prices in the near term.

As the week draws to a close, market participants are bracing for potential shifts in oil prices based on the latest economic news and geopolitical developments. The global oil market remains on edge as it navigates through a complex web of factors influencing supply and demand dynamics.
